Output ac658773b6b90fbb1e17aa704ebfd5f7025b4ca198e1514c63b08e76bc4b56a8:1

value
26351064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c51986b945916725fbcab9f3d8620c045f2c7e4 OP_EQUAL
address
3Qh9xERRK8w6MJiVdqhtuyJ43sNZmnoi7y
transaction
ac658773b6b90fbb1e17aa704ebfd5f7025b4ca198e1514c63b08e76bc4b56a8
confirmations
343007
spent
true